![]() |
Ejecutar query una sola vez al dia
Hola, el caso es que tengo en un form para hacer el ticket, una grilla con los productos agregados, para agregarlo hay que hacer click en agregar producto que lleva a un form con un dbgrid obviamente.
Pero como puedo ejecutar el query del dataset una sola vez y no cada vez que se abra el form, osea una sola vez por dia, lo unico que tengo que hacer es si el admin del sistema modifica un precio que se cambie, pero la consulta en si se tiene que ejecutar una vez nomas. |
Yo no entiendo lo que dices, ni tampoco si estás informando o preguntando algo :confused:
|
Cita:
|
Cita:
Tal como plateas la pregunta, una posible respuesta podría ser que realizaras la consulta y luego guardaras los datos en local (XML por ejemplo). El resto de veces sólo tienes que cargar los datos locales hasta que al día siguiente vuelvas a realizar la consulta y vuelvas a generar los datos en local. Pero me da la impresión de que esto no es a lo que te estás refiriendo... |
Disculpen
Bueno disculpen mi poca explicacion.
Es una aplicacion cliente que utilizara el vendedor de un negocio.Si tengo el formulario del ticket, ![]() cuando el cliente quiere un producto hace click en Agregar Producto, que le va a mostrar al vendedor la grilla de productos ![]() El va a seleccionar uno introducir la cantidad y agregarlo al detalle del ticket. Pero siempre que haga agregar producto se va a realizar la consulta que llena el dbgrid, y esto es mucha carga. Entonces como puedo consultar una sola vez al dia? Muchas gracias.. |
Cita:
Lo que te recomiendo entonces, es que en conjunto con tu DBA generen una vista (View) que realice éste trabajo de mostrar los datos actuales, mostrando el resultado del proceso de repreciación de artículos. |
La franja horaria es GMT +2. Ahora son las 23:51:53. |
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i